Dog fever typically lasts about 1 to 3 days. However, if your dog's fever persists longer or is accompanied by other symptoms, consult a vet immediately. Prolonged fever could indicate a more serious underlying issue. Ensure your dog stays hydrated and comfortable while monitoring their symptoms closely.

  1. What is the normal duration of fever in dogs? Dog fever typically lasts about 1 to 3 days under normal circumstances.
  2. When should I take my dog to the vet for a fever? If your dog's fever lasts longer than 3 days or comes with other symptoms like lethargy, loss of appetite, or breathing difficulties, you should consult a veterinarian immediately.
  3. How can I help my dog if it has a fever? Ensure your dog stays hydrated and comfortable while monitoring their symptoms closely. Avoid giving human medications and seek vet advice if symptoms persist.
